Transaction 4c39383836f07abce8b1ce4f03bb692960fabb22016d09a973bd80f35c3122b2
1 Input
1 Output
-
4c39383836f07abce8b1ce4f03bb692960fabb22016d09a973bd80f35c3122b2:0
- value
- 137312729
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5178a174bb0a9aa16ca7bbc4339ae1b4d9d4ffb
- address
- ltc1q65tc596tkz5659k20w7yxwdwrdxe6nlmk54kef